Output 3afebf820c509ef136e558d2d318f068f2fd9db9d7e71d565be4cc5079d03125:0

value
27996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b51cdf26f9abfca09143e0e31ad38bc288875c OP_EQUAL
address
3Cy815L7Tnbvo9QvyzPaicyiVHTZYSHsxb
transaction
3afebf820c509ef136e558d2d318f068f2fd9db9d7e71d565be4cc5079d03125
confirmations
42500
spent
true